Transaction 21e9833558d488ba7056758b1593e483fb54b0159d5ec6c24a1d3f0fac843436

2 Input
2 Outputs
  • 21e9833558d488ba7056758b1593e483fb54b0159d5ec6c24a1d3f0fac843436:0
  • value  335243466
    address  1FbZccrnjboGjBpLwxyqg33335qqV1EBm7
  • 21e9833558d488ba7056758b1593e483fb54b0159d5ec6c24a1d3f0fac843436:1
  • value  864750658
    address  12yyhxYemFTcWHSTMJrLthWcAmqxFmgxMC